The PBD Double Lateral Credenza with Drawers is a customer favorite for good reason — it stacks two lateral file cabinets side by side and adds a box drawer row above each section, giving you filing capacity plus convenient supply storage all in one 72-inch unit. Each lateral section accommodates letter or legal files, and the drawers lock with a single key for security. The additional box drawers mean you're not cramming pens and phone chargers into your file drawers.
At 37¾ inches tall (due to the drawer stacks), this unit sits higher than a standard 30-inch credenza — it works as a storage unit behind the desk rather than as a secondary work surface. The extra height actually works in its favor in open offices where you want a visual divider. Available in multiple finishes, with Mahogany being the perennial top seller for its traditional executive aesthetic. At 471 pounds, it's the heaviest unit in the lineup.

The PBD Double Wood Door Storage Credenza is the right pick when your storage needs are less about filing and more about stashing equipment, supplies, or items you need to keep out of sight. Both wood door sections each have an adjustable interior shelf, and each section locks independently — so you can give different staff access to different sides without handing out a master key. The box drawers above each section lock separately for additional quick-access security.
At the same 72-inch width and 37¾-inch height as the Most Popular pick, the configuration is the key difference — you're trading lateral filing capacity for shelf space. If your office runs mostly digital records or you already have a separate lateral file and just need a credenza-height storage piece, this is the practical choice. Modern Walnut is a clean contemporary finish that works in updated office environments.

What to Look For in a Combo Credenza
Storage Configuration
The most important choice is what you're actually storing. If you have ongoing paper filing needs, you want at least one lateral file section. If you're primarily storing supplies and equipment, wood door or sliding door storage sections give you more usable shelf space. The combo format lets you do both — pick the ratio based on your actual workflow, not just what looks good in a catalog photo.
Width and Footprint
Full-size combo credenzas run 71–72 inches wide. That's the right size to place behind most executive desks without overcrowding the space. If your office is smaller, a 54-inch compact unit keeps the same functionality in a shorter run. Depth is typically 22–24 inches — shallow enough to fit along most walls without cutting into walking space.
Height — Work Surface vs. Storage Only
A 30-inch credenza sits at standard desk height and can double as a work surface or equipment stand. Units at 37–38 inches (which include a drawer stack on top) work better as dedicated storage since the height is awkward for seated work. Know which one you need before ordering.
Locking Security
Any credenza that will hold confidential files or secure supplies needs locking drawers. Look for units where a single lock secures all related drawers — it's more convenient than multiple keys and more likely to actually get used. For units with multiple separate sections, independent locks give you better access control.
Finish and Durability
Laminate finishes hold up well in office environments — they resist scratches, stains, and daily contact better than painted finishes. Darker finishes like Espresso, Mahogany, and Dark Roast hide fingerprints and minor scuffs. Contemporary finishes like Modern Walnut and Urban Walnut work well if you're updating your office aesthetic. Match your credenza finish to your desk for a cohesive look.
Combo Credenza FAQs
What's the difference between a credenza and a combo credenza?
A standard credenza is basically a long, low storage cabinet — usually with shelves or doors. A combo credenza combines two different storage types in one unit, typically pairing a lateral file cabinet (for hanging files) with a storage cabinet (for supplies, binders, or equipment). The combo format means you get organized filing and general storage in the same footprint, which is far more practical for most offices than buying two separate pieces.
What size combo credenza do I need for my office?
The most common width is 72 inches — that's two 36-inch cabinet sections side by side. It's the sweet spot that fits behind most executive desks without crowding the room. If you're tight on space, a 54-inch compact unit works for lighter filing needs. Depth is typically 22 to 24 inches, which keeps the credenza flush with standard desk depth. Height ranges from about 30 inches (standard work surface height) to 37–38 inches for units with drawer stacks on top.
Can a combo credenza work as a secondary work surface?
Yes, and that's one of the best uses for them. At 29 to 30 inches tall, most combo credenzas sit at standard desk height, so the top becomes useful workspace — room for a printer, a monitor, or just overflow work surface when you're spreading out on a project. The units at 37–38 inches (which have a drawer tower built on top) are better for storage only since the height doesn't match standard desk ergonomics for seated work.
How much can a combo credenza hold in terms of filing capacity?
A standard 36-inch wide lateral file section with two drawers holds approximately 300 to 400 hanging file folders per drawer, accommodating both letter and legal size files. A full 72-inch combo unit with two lateral file sections gives you roughly 1,200 to 1,600 folders of filing capacity — more than enough for a busy executive office. If you need serious filing volume, look for units with a File/File (FF) lateral configuration rather than Box/Box/File.
Do I need to bolt a combo credenza to the wall?
For most office environments, no — full-size combo credenzas at 441 pounds or more are heavy enough to stay put on their own. The units that need wall anchoring are taller storage cabinets and bookshelves that could tip forward if loaded incorrectly. That said, if you're placing a credenza in a high-traffic area with younger staff or a school-type environment, anchoring is always the safer call.
What's the best combo credenza finish for a conference room?
Espresso, Mahogany, and Mocha are classic conference room finishes — they read as professional and hold up well against fingerprints and daily contact. Modern Walnut and Urban Walnut are solid choices if you're going for a more contemporary look. Avoid very light finishes like white or cream in high-use conference rooms — they show scuffs and marks more quickly than darker laminates.
